Title: Scott Steelman: Innovator in Microfluidics and Labeling Technologies
Introduction
Scott Steelman is a notable inventor based in Wilmington, MA (US). He has made significant contributions to the fields of microfluidics and labeling technologies. With a total of 3 patents, his work has advanced the capabilities of reagent delivery systems and agent labeling methods.
Latest Patents
Scott's latest patents include innovative solutions that address complex challenges in his field. One of his notable inventions is titled "Compositions and methods for labeling of agents." This invention provides methods for uniquely labeling populations of agents of interest using random combinations of oligonucleotides. The oligonucleotides may comprise a unique nucleotide sequence and/or one or more non-nucleic acid detectable moieties. Another significant patent is the "High-throughput dynamic reagent delivery system," which relates to systems and methods for manipulating droplets within a high-throughput microfluidic system.
